Who are we:
We are Hadrian - an offensive cybersecurity startup. We are reshaping the future of cybersecurity through the power of agentic AI injected with the hacker’s perspective. Founded in August 2021, we've secured funding and the backing of ABN AMRO Ventures and Cherry Ventures, propelling us into a new era.
Our goal is to provide companies with an autonomous Threat Exposure Management platform. At Hadrian, we view security through a hacker's eyes because hackers understand hackers best. We continuously map the digital footprint of organisations, discover risks, and prioritise remediation for security teams to harden their external attack surfaces.

Your Role:
As Field Marketing Manager at Hadrian, you will own the strategy and execution of regional field and event marketing across the United States. You will build relationships with sales and demand teams, design high-impact programmes, and run events and regional campaigns that accelerate pipeline and expand brand awareness.
You will be responsible for planning end-to-end event experiences, regional ABM activations, partner co-marketing, and local demand generation initiatives. This role requires a hands-on operator who can work across time zones, manage vendors, measure performance, and optimise spend to maximise ROI.
Reporting to the Head of Marketing, you will collaborate closely with Sales, Product Marketing, and Comms to align field activities to GTM priorities and to ensure consistent brand and messaging across all customer touchpoints.
What you will do as Field Marketing Manager at Hadrian:
Pipeline Generation: Design and execute an integrated mix of marketing campaigns to engage key personas within our ICP. This includes organizing events (conferences, roundtables, strategic vertical-focused events), account-based marketing campaigns, and through-channel initiatives.
Regional Expertise: Act as the marketing authority for North America. Partner closely with Account Executives to align on financial targets, funnel goals, and high-priority accounts. Deploy tailored tactics to penetrate and convert these accounts effectively.
Cross-Functional Collaboration: Collaborate with digital, content, and other internal teams to deliver cohesive messaging across various campaign formats.
Budget Management: Own the regional field marketing budget, ensuring efficient allocation and delivering measurable ROI.
Channel Program Support: Work alongside the Channel Director to design and support channel programs while building strong relationships with channel partners in the region.
Performance Measurement: Track and report on key KPIs, including campaign ROI, pipeline contribution, and the quality and effectiveness of marketing materials and events.
Swiss Army Knife of Project Management: As the sole marketer for the US region, you will act as the central point of contact for key programmes owned by HQ but executed regionally, including PR, ABM, and regional webinars. You will be responsible for coordinating stakeholders, ensuring seamless local execution, and adapting global initiatives to maximise regional impact.
